Always roll, never fold a carpet

I purchased 4 of these carpets: two of the 4'x 5', an 8' x 10' and the 9'2" x 12'5". All of these carpets were received rolled up except the largest one, the 9'2" x 12'5". This last one was folded in half length wise and then repeatedly folded from on end to the other. Anyone who know anything about carpets knows you never fold a carpet, always role up the carpet. This causes a problem in getting the carpet to lie flat. The trick in gettting a carpet to lie flat is to unroll it and then role it back up opposite the way it was rolled up when you received it --- first from one end and then repeating form the other end and squeezing it gently as you roll. Then roll it out top side up and work the ends binding the carpet under so they lie flat. This procedure usually works pretty well for the most part if the carpet is rolled up. If it is folded this doesn't work. In my case the larger carpet which was folded lies flat for the most part but still has several areas where it does not. So just be prepared for this problem if you buy the larger 9'2" x 12'5" size carpet. As for the smell other reviewers complained about, I only noticed a slight smell which quickly disappeared. Considering the low price, I would say the quality is very good and the colors and design are very nice indeed.
